I will add to this that Ty is doing him a great favor. The chances of Hill making it to the NFL probably weren't great to begin with after all the injuries, but were completely non-existent if he arrived at a training camp having never learned certain skills NFL teams are looking for. They like athleticism, but they also need someone who can run an NFL offense. It's been telling that the commentators in each game so far have talked about how Hill needs to learn how to place the ball where the receiver is going to be rather than wait for him to be open before he throws. That is what NFL teams expect and what Ty would like for Hill to learn how to do. You don't have to learn that skill if your running has been your main thing throughout your career, I guess.
